- Acrylic paint, q-tips, glue, scissors, paint holders
Hook (5 mins) Introduce and explain Metis Beadwork to students through Canva
Explain Activity (10 Explain what students will complete in Art. Students will first cut out
mins) an animal they drew using yellow construction paper and glue it
down on black construction paper. They will use whatever colours
they wish and use q tips to make dots around their animal (at least
4 rounds) and then can make other objects still using circular
patterns and dots.
Activity (40 mins) 1. Students draw their animal on yellow construction paper
a. (the animal can be a lizard, turtle, butterfly, etc.)
2. Students cut out their chosen animal
3. Students will glue down their animal on black construction
4. After students have finished glueing their animal down, they
will pick 3-4 colours to paint with and create 4 rounds
around their animal.
5. Students can either continue making rounds around their
animal or make circular rounds of other objects.
Closure (5 mins) As a class, we will discuss how we felt during this activity.
Guiding Questions:
● How did you find yourself when you were doing this
artwork? Was it stressful or peaceful?
● Why did you think it was stressful/peaceful
